Linux for Dummies, 5th Edition
Not everyone can Read The Fine Manual Wiley's "For Dummies" series tends to provoke polarized reactions, so here's fair warning: I love them more than I loathe them -- partly out of contrarianism, partly because I often fall well within their target demographic. If the folksy, self-deprecating tone of these books infuriates you as it does many people, most likely it's because you aren't part of the target audience. No one likes being talked down to. On the other hand, for many people who might otherwise be interested in switching to Linux (or at least playing with it more), being told to look at man pages is like being told to drive up a brick wall, and books like Linux for Dummies are a welcome resource both to learn from and to point out to others. Promises, promises Linux for Dummies' back cover says it will teach the reader how to work with popular Linux distributions (specifically, Fedora, SUSE and Mandrake), choose an ISP and configure dialup access, understand bash syntax, install and use OpenOffice.org, and manage the Linux file system. It does all of these things, to a reasonable depth, but don't expect a heavy tutorial on any one of them: the whole point is naming and defusing common newbie problems. A DVD included with the book contains Red Hat's Fedora Core 1 and source code, making it a reasonable way to obtain that distro as well.LeBlanc is a good instructor; since she does computer training professionally, it's not surprising this book is organized well for self-directed learning, albeit at a pace that readers installing Gentoo on obscure hardware would likely find boring -- Chapter 6, 82 pages in, is titled "Dip in those toes." To be fair, by that point the book has zipped right through readying a system for and then installing a Linux distribution, and booting up for the first time. Not bad, really.
The early chapters leading up to that toe-dipping fulfill parts of the back cover's promises, by going through a graphical Fedora installation step-by-step (showing the user how to fill in each blank and go on to the next stage), then adding in the next chapter Mandrake- and SUSE-specific differences, emphasizing the similarities more than the idiosyncrasies.
The book's later chapters cover connecting to the Internet (via ethernet or modem), using a number of commonly included programs for email, web-browsing, word-processing and other workaday tasks, manipulating several types of files (for plaintext, this book leans understandably toward vi over emacs, but where are pine or joe?), navigating and lightly tweaking both GNOME and KDE, playing music and video files, and securing and updating one's system. Since there's clearly no way one book can address all of these things to the satisfaction of an advanced reader in 360 pages of text, don't look at the book that way: instead, the text provides a chatty overview of big issues (a few hundred words on why to avoid unnecessarily running as root, say), links to websites around the net for longer explanations, and skips completely religious wars about text editors, licenses, and proper window management.
When it comes to applications, this book is oriented toward desktop use; Apache doesn't even make the index. Chapters 7, 8 and 9 cover connecting to and using the Internet. Chapter 7 is all about the technical side of this -- setting up a working connection (with a friendly, necessary warning that not all modems, and not all ISPs, are equally adept at handling anything other than Windows), assigning IP numbers (or using DHCP) and using tools like traceroute to verify that things are working right. 8 and 9 cover various Internet tools, leaning toward Mozilla and Evolution for web-browsing and email, respectively. (Konqueror gets a one-line mention as a web-browser here, which is a bit short considering its strong KDE integration and dual life as a file browser.)
Working with file permissions and directories (both with and without a GUI) occupies Chapter 10, while 11 goes strictly into working from the command line. It's no In the Beginning Was the Command Line , but it does an admirable job of introducing the most necessary command line tools without straying into esoterica: things like ls, cd, pwd, man, clear and kill, in other words, the ones without which it would be hard to get around a system.
Chapter 14 is solely about using OpenOffice.org; it covers the drawing, presentation, spreadsheet, math and word-processing modules well enough to get started with each one. While there's a lot to be said for Abiword (clean, quick) and KOffice (frame orientation is very useful), OO.org is probably the most sensible office software to focus on in a book aimed at a non-expert audience. (And for the moment, anyhow, I find it the most compatible with Microsoft's office suite, which lends it considerable power in the form of network effects.) The chapter provided does as much justice to the suite, with lucid first steps outlined for common tasks like writing a text document and doing simple calculations with the Math module, as roughly 30 pages can be expected to.
By contrast, Chapter 18, devoted to securing one's system by way of passwords, network management and use of SSH, is only 13 pages long. (For the moment, that may be enough for this book, but I suspect by the next edition it won't be.) Still, quick but workable explanations of connecting from the Linux desktop to remote machines via ssh, and connecting Windows clients via ssh to your new Linux box, at least close some of the most obvious security holes, as does the advice to close down unneeded ports and daemons.
Screenshots throughout (cleanly printed greyscale) are well-chosen; this is one of the improvements that this edition has over the 1st edition I gave to my father a few years ago. Most of the screenshots reflect the author's choice of GUI programs over terminals, including graphical utilities for things like setting security options. By choosing Fedora's, LeBlanc sidesteps arguments about KDE vs. GNOME aesthetics -- since the images use the default Bluecurve theme (which looks just about identical under both of the most common windowing environments), I'm not even sure which environment was used to create most of them.
Two appendices close the book: the shorter (second) one lists the contents of the included DVD and system requirements; the longer one which precedes it provides a listing of common commands from alias to xxd (about which more below).
Along for the ride The included DVD is a compromise between audience (self-diagnosed computer dummies) and practicality (fitting six CDs' worth of Fedora into a book jacket with minimal fuss). The machine I set aside to play with Fedora doesn't have a DVD drive, so I used a standard download from Red Hat to play along with the examples. (I didn't bump into any contradictions between screen and page, but that's Situation Normal, since I used the same distribution.)
(Aside: though for various reasons Fedora does make a wise choice in a book like this, I hope future editions, or competing books in the non-expert-user niche, will use Live CDs such as Knoppix instead. That would open them up to users who want to mess around with Linux more before crossing their fingers and wiping a hard drive.)
There's one more freebie -- a single-sheet tear-out reference sheet listing common commands and a few of their options, including a list of the right commands to mount CDs under the Red Hat and Mandrake (identical) and SUSE (just slightly different enough to confuse). It only has to get used a few times to be worthwhile.
The gloss ceiling The same brief-and-breezy approach that makes the book worthwhile for some purposes (like not abandoning the audience) sometimes just makes it confusing; in several places the compromises necessary in boiling down a complex subject for a beginner audience made me itch to pencil in suggestions.
A few more pages worth of one-line summaries would have made the Appendix A, (the one on common Linux commands), far more valuable. As it is, LeBlanc lists a number of general categories (Printing, System Control, Communication, etc), summaries each category, and lists several built-in commands relevant to each.
Under the heading of 'Communication,' for example, she points out that sysadmins find the listed utilities "useful for providing information about users and communicating with them," then provides a handful of commands: finger, wall, write, and who. And while the section starts out with the advice to look up each command's man page if curious, this section strikes me as filler in its current configuration -- it could be struck to make more room discussing Live CDs, or vector drawing apps, or Mozilla's mail client as an alternative to Evolution.
Many applications are given short shrift simply because an adequate treatment of more window managers, graphics programs (two and a half pages dedicated to the GIMP is more than most programs get), music players and all the rest would have meant a far thicker book. I wish a few pages had been spared for at least capsule descriptions of pico and nano (my favorite text editors for Dummies -- err, "future experts" -- including me), Xchat, and gaim. Also on the wishlist: Wiley would commission LeBlanc to write a similar book aimed squarely at schools, in which applications like Scribus and some of the many Edutainment packages could be emphasized instead.
Since I've been dealing (arguing) with a wireless network in the time I've had this book, there's one other thing I wish this text didn't skip, which is a tutorial on connecting Linux systems via 802.11. The typical distro's autodetection abilities and set-up tools have improved to the point where this would be no more complicated to explain (and probably more useful) than the provided explanation of connecting through a modem.
The Upshot for Dummies Linux for Dummies isn't for everyone; it leaves out far more than it includes, leading to what would for advanced users be egregious omissions. However, for new, intermediate and merely rusty users, this book easily justifies its $30 pricetag -- as a confidence boost to the absolute beginner, and a refresher to everyone else. Linux, for various reasons of various worth, can certainly be cryptic (the same can be said of Windows and probably every OS under the sun), but a little bit of executive summarizing can inspire a would-be user, so he can actually enjoy and understand using it. Kudos to LeBlanc for providing that kind of catalyst.

There may be two problems here -- one personal, and one more technical.
First, Unix people may read "cryptic" as a slander, and others may use it as such as well: for "cryptic", read "obfuscated". The slanderous implication is that programmers make complicated interfaces for no good reason -- or specifically for a bad reason, such as to maintain prestige or "job security". This is, or at least feels like, a personal attack: "Computers are not inherently hard to use. Computer nerds have deliberately made them hard to use, in order to hurt me. Therefore, my inability to use computers productively is not due to my own refusal to learn; it is, rather, due to their malicious action."
Second, the unexpressed alternatives to "cryptic" may well be "verbose" and "dumbed-down", and being cryptic may be the least of these three evils. A syntax appears cryptic when it tries to represent a large amount of complexity without requiring a large amount of typing. For a powerful syntax which prefers verbosity over crypticity, see COBOL -- by all reports a capable programming language, but one that few wish to use because it requires you write ADD 1 TO X GIVING X where C has x++;.
If one wishes a system to be neither verbose nor cryptic, the only option is to dumb it down: to remove capabilities which can only be represented with complicated expressions. Most Unix programs are far more powerful than their Windows analogues; you can do much more with the find command than you can with Windows' GUI equivalent.
Most Unix programmers choose likewise: if one has the choice to be either dumbed-down, or verbose, or cryptic, one should choose the last of these. Why? Of the three, the cryptic (but not maliciously obfuscated) system is the one which most rewards learning. Becoming an expert in a dumbed-down system is no great shakes: you can't do much more than the novice can, because all the system's functionality is geared towards the novice. Becoming an expert in a verbose system gives you power, but you have to wear your fingers down to stubs. Becoming an expert in a cryptic system allows you all that power without so much pain.
